Stylish Double Basins For Your Next Renovation
If you are remodeling your kitchen area or bathroom and are looking for a double basin, you can find many options in the marketplace. You will be please to discover so many cool new possibilities obtainable these days to meet your needs. Some sinks feature a low-profile divider. The purpose of this divider is to improve accommodation of larger items inside the sink, like pots and pans. It also ensures that the water does not overflow onto the countertops or floors. Be sure that the sink you purchase includes one of these low-profile dividers and you will benefit significantly and steer clear of unnecessary spills.
A double basin kitchen sink is pretty practical because it enables you to use one basin for washing dishes and the other basin for scraping or rinsing food into it. This sink is also fantastic for the avid chef that needs to cook many courses simultaneously. You can prep vegetables in one side of the sink while thawing frozen meats in the other side.
It is definitely a luxury to have on holidays, like Thanksgiving and Christmas, along with other special occasions, like birthdays and dinner parties, where a vast array of dishes must be prepared. Following your feast, you could wash all of the dirty dishes in one half of the sink. And in the other half of the sink, you are able to place pots and pans that may need some soaking because of all of your yummy sauces. As you can imagine, there’s plenty of possibility for infinite uses.
These sinks are also available for bathrooms. It is possible to install them in a vanity or obtain a wall hung basin to mount to your bathroom walls. If you have a substantially large family, getting ready in the morning time will be easier. The extra basin will allow others to utilize the faucet whenever they need. You will practically eradicate the tedious requirement that your spouse and children have to stand in a line at the door impatiently waiting for their turn to use the sink. Finally, an end to the morning ritual of banging on the bathroom door.
Out of the 3 selections of single, double, or triple basin sinks, most men and women choose a double basin, not merely for its practicality, but also its appearance. These sinks can be handcrafted from your choice of granite, stainless steel, cast iron, metal, stone, and even solid marble. The costs for one ranges from a hundred dollars to thousands of dollars based on the model that you decide on. These days there are many kinds of sinks obtainable with a double basin: apron front, undercounter, surface mount, etc. You’ll undoubtedly be able to obtain one that will enhance the design you have in mind for the remodel.
